Software Engineer, TigerGraph

Core Engine

$150-180k

Docker
Kubernetes
Java
Linux
Go
C++
Mid and Senior level
San Francisco Bay Area

Office located in Redwood City, CA

TigerGraph

Scalable graph analytics platform

Job no longer available

TigerGraph

Scalable graph analytics platform

101-200 employees

B2BEnterpriseBig dataSaaSData Analysis

Job no longer available

$150-180k

Docker
Kubernetes
Java
Linux
Go
C++
Mid and Senior level
San Francisco Bay Area

Office located in Redwood City, CA

101-200 employees

B2BEnterpriseBig dataSaaSData Analysis

Company mission

To uncover meaningful, actionable, real-time insights from data.

Role

Who you are

  • Join this team if you have a passion for building distributed technology platforms and tools to solve the most complex real-life business problems
  • PhD or MS in Computer Science or related major
  • 3+ years of experience in distributed database or BS + 5 year of experience
  • Using or Developing experience on distributed/parallel database engine
  • Proficient programming experience in C++
  • Strong understanding of database concurrency and consistency
  • Good understanding in memory management, file I/O, network & socket programming, concurrency / multithreading
  • Good troubleshooting skills
  • Passionate and creative team player and independent thinker

Desirable

  • Solid programming skills, familiar with at least one of the following programming languages C++, Java or Go
  • Hands-on experience with Linux and shell
  • Good knowledge of operating systems
  • Excellent problem-solving skills, good communication skills, and team spirit
  • Proficient in C++, Java or Go languages
  • Good knowledge of distributed systems
  • Experience with multi-threaded programming
  • Familiar with Docker containers
  • Familiar with Kubernetes
  • TopCoder, Codeforces, ACM-ICPC / OI competition experience
  • Open-source project contribution experience

What the job involves

  • The Engineering team at TigerGraph, Inc. has built the world's fastest real-time Graph Analytics platform. We are seeking a Staff Software Engineer to add to our world-class core engineering team
  • The Engineer will help design and deliver the world's fastest distributed graph database and analytics platform
  • Ensure data consistency and durability with great performance and scalability
  • Ensure service high availability within the cluster and cross regions
  • Lead innovation for core engine components and subsystems
  • Design and develop architectural innovations to connect our cutting-edge technology with other ecosystems
  • Recommend and drive key technology decisions including researching and adopting new technologies and leading the implementation

Otta's take

Theo Margolius headshot

Theo Margolius

COO of Otta

TigerGraph specialises in graph databases - which are powerful databases that can connect multiple data points at once. Purpose built to manage large amounts of highly connected data, flexible and easily scalable, this technology is becoming increasingly preferred over traditional relational databases.

Its substantial funding has enabled TigerGraph to expand, now with support for Google Cloud Platform workloads, putting TigerGraph in the unique position of being the only distributed graph database to be made available as SaaS on all major cloud platforms. In addition, connectors for Snowflake and Salesforce Tableau further enhance the integration options for TigerGraph. GraphStudio, a graphical user interface for TigerGraph DB brings together all aspects of the graph database analysis in one application created specifically for ease of use.

TigerGraph is currently the fastest graph database in the world, ahead of competitors such as Neo4j, ArangoDB and Redis, a position the business will no doubt be eager to maintain as it is a key differentiator.

Insights

Top investors

Some candidates hear
back within 2 weeks

-55% employee growth in 12 months

Company

Funding (last 2 of 6 rounds)

Feb 2021

$105m

SERIES C

Sep 2019

$32m

SERIES B

Total funding: $194.2m

Company benefits

  • Putting money in your bank with competitive pay and attractive equity
  • The best health, dental and vision insurance to keep you healthy
  • Catered lunches and a well-stocked kitchen
  • Take time off when you want and recharge your batteries
  • Fun environment with team outings and a recreation lounge, including ping-pong and foosball

Company values

  • See it from the customer's POV
  • Work as a team; support one another
  • Be resourceful, have fun
  • The buck stops with yu/you
  • Focus on craftsmanship
  • Earn your stripes
  • Be curious, ask questions

Company HQ

Redwood Shores, Redwood City, CA

Founders

Yu Xu

(CTO)

Dr. Xu received their Ph.D in Computer Science and Engineering from the University of California San Diego. Prior to founding TigerGraph, Dr. Xu worked on Twitter’s data infrastructure for massive data analytics. Before that, they worked as Teradata’s Hadoop architect where they led the company’s big data initiatives.

Salary benchmarks

We don't have enough data yet to provide salary benchmarks for this role.

Submit your salary to help other candidates with crowdsourced salary estimates.

Share this job